@ others talking about w build:
In my experience W build is a trap that forces an incredibly inflexible playstyle and has a lower impact than her damage build. The issue is that you can’t really take her cleanse without high inquisitor because the downside is very severe unless you have the desperation removal.
It is dumb but having a hero built around doing damage in order to heal have so little damage and have her damage come in the form of a self root and clunky skillshot is arguably worse. Use it on your allies with the Lvl 1 Clemency.
if you use clemency you’re healing only one ally, its really not something you should use if you can avoid it. You’d get much more out of using your W on an enemy. The main reason clemency is picked is for the W cdr alongside high inquisitor. The active is very mediocre.
I only found Clemecy to become viable post 16 with Shared Punishment other than that it’s not really the best option for healing, well in combat of course, out of combat is pretty ok.
